A flash of light passes my brain as I remember a cold, icy voice. My eyes edge slowly to the jut in the wall. The voice of the angels pierces my heart as the air around me seems to suddenly freeze, stopping me in my tracks, sneering around me. "Rescue me, somebody! Help!" but my woeful screaming is no use against this tough, stone wall.The angels laugh, their deafening voice are enough to waken the dead. Only I, Millie North, can survive the conditions and diseases of this ancient, battered room. If only John was here, I would've escaped, but, no. John isn't here and I will never escape.
Since I'm the only survivor, the guards think I'm invincible, but that's just them. I was born in jail and basically live in jail. My mum was the one who decided to leave me in jail, but as cruel as this is,it was for the best. "I'm coming!!!" Cries out a voice. I scramble through the dust to peak out of the window. A figure with brown hair is climbing up the tower! It must be John! But before I can call out to him, he disappears.
It's been 1 day and I still haven't seen John, or whoever tried to rescue me. "Millie! it's me, John!" I look into the cabin beside me. " John!" I exclaim, smiling happily. But then I realize that he's tied up and chained to. I guess some stories don't have a happy ending!
